The 1N4733AG is a 5.1 V zener diode rated for 1 W continuous power dissipation in a DO-41 axial-lead package. The 5.1 V nominal voltage with ±5% tolerance means the regulation point sits between 4.845 V and 5.355 V — a window tight enough for most 5 V rail clamping or reference applications. At 1 W, the maximum steady-state current through the zener is roughly 196 mA (1 W / 5.1 V), but the 7 Ohm max impedance (Zzt) means the voltage will shift about 7 mV per mA of load change — a factor to budget if the shunt current varies widely.
Temperature range and leakage — suitability for harsh environments
The -65°C to +175°C operating range covers military, automotive under-hood, and downhole tooling without derating the junction temperature. Reverse leakage is 10 µA max at 1 V reverse — low enough that it won't upset a high-impedance bias node at room temperature, though leakage doubles roughly every 10°C above 25°C. Forward voltage is 1.2 V max at 200 mA — if the zener is used as a bidirectional clamp, the forward drop adds to the clamping threshold on the negative swing.
